paint.net Portable 5.0 (image and photo editor) Released

John T. Haller's picture
Submitted by John T. Haller on January 19, 2023 - 6:35pm

paint.net Portable has been released. paint.net is an easy to use but full featured photo and image editor. It's packaged in PortableApps.com Format for easy use from any portable device and integration with the PortableApps.com Platform. paint.net is free for personal and business use.

Features

ScreenshotPaint.NET is image and photo editing software for PCs that run Windows. It features an intuitive and innovative user interface with support for layers, unlimited undo, special effects, and a wide variety of useful and powerful tools. An active and growing online community provides friendly help, tutorials, and plugins. Learn more about paint.net...

PortableApps.com Installer / PortableApps.com Format

paint.net Portable is packaged in a PortableApps.com Installer so it will automatically detect an existing PortableApps.com installation when your drive is plugged in. And it's in PortableApps.com Format, so it automatically works with the PortableApps.com Platform including the Menu and Backup Utility.

With this release paint.net now only supports Windows 10 64-bit and Windows 11. When upgrading on a Windows 7 or 8 machine or a Windows 10 32-bit machine, a PaintDotNetPortableLegacyWin7 version will be created alongside the existing upgrade to allow it to continue to work.
